Sisters of Life Visit Kellenberg for Spiritual Presentation

Article by Phoenix writer Delaney Clark ’25:

On Thursday, February 16th, the Senior, Junior, and Sophomore divisions gathered in the auditorium for a presentation by the Sisters of Life.

Sister Charity, S.V., Sister Madeline, S.V., and Sister Cecilia, S.V., shared their personal calls to faith and the vocation of Sisters of Life.

The presentation started off with a fun competition between the three divisions before shifting to an environment where students could embrace their message.

The Sisters’ fourth vow, which is unique to their order, is a vow to protect and enhance the sacredness of human life. With this vow, the sisters are able to help make an impact in Pro-Life movements.

Each of the sisters spoke about how wonderful it is that they get the chance to meet and assist so many mothers, fathers, and children by bringing God into their lives.

Sophomore Amanda Punturieri reflected that, “It was just so amazing to see the enthusiasm of the three sisters on stage. Anyone could tell that they really cared about each and every one of us and were very happy that they got to share their message with high school students.”

The Kellenberg community was very fortunate to have this visit and presentation from the Sisters of Life.
